## Video: Australian Company Qantas to Cut 5,000 Jobs

[Watch (HLS stream): Australian Company Qantas to Cut 5,000 Jobs](https://cdn.jwplayer.com/manifests/dPEGo8o0.m3u8) (2:38)

![Australian Company Qantas to Cut 5,000 Jobs](https://cdn.jwplayer.com/v2/media/dPEGo8o0/poster.jpg?width=720)

_Published 2014-02-27. Qantas Airways on Thursday said it will cut 5,000 jobs and posted a first-half loss of 235 million Australian dollars._

## Transcript

>> His entrance was upbeat but it was all downhill from there for Alan Joyce.

>> Today I announce that Qantas reported an underlying loss before tax of $ 252 million. -$ 235 million after tax following a [ unk ] performance from Qantas International, Qantas Domestic and Jetstar, unacceptable he said.

>> And the current position is unsustainable.

>> So, as a consequence of that first half loss, 5, 000 staff will be cut over three years, spending slashed by $ 2 billion and a wage freeze for all. Mr. Joyce will take a 36 percent cut to his three million plus salary not that it's his fault.

>> For the past five years Australia has been hit by a giant wave of new airline seats from foreign carriers.

>> Among the money saving measures, 50 aircrafts will be sold or delivery deferred. The $ 112 million sale of its Brisbane terminal lease, restructure of maintenance and catering and the axing of the Perth- Singapore route. Of the job cuts, 15, 000 are office roles. This morning they were filing in to hear the bad news. Pilots and cabin crews are also at risk. Unions reacted angrily even threatening to strike.

>> Industrial action is some of the-- the workforce should be considering as a tool and has a right to do.

>> The airlines' customers were left shaking their heads. How do they get to this?

>> I think it's very said and I think that perhaps Mr. Joyce should look at his position.

>> Compared to other airlines, I don't know. I seem to really lose the [ unk ].

>> How can we support a company that doesn't support Australians?

>> A lean of Qantas Alan Joyce says with cuts to jobs and spending but not a guarantee to its reputation for safety. But Union say 175 line maintenance workers will go.

>> As long as there's no change in direction from the Qantas Board, there's no hope for the future of this airline. Industry expert say under siege from Virgin, Qantas has a tough job cutting back to survive or staying premium.

>> From even on a courtroom yells have gone through the floor especially this competition. They've got-- they've got to maintain a high profile, high quality product.

>> I know it's a lot of pain for-- for a number of people, a lot of people but they really have to get their co- structure under control because they are simply too expensive compared to their [ unk ] competitors.

>> Unions will meet Qantas tomorrow to discuss the future that many of their workers weren't have one.

>> I've never seen such despondency for a-- a non- staff that I saw in the last 24 hours.
